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
74 CLEVELAND ROAD Detached £2,281,994 £1,320,000 20 Oct 2011
76 CLEVELAND ROAD Detached £1,690,280 £580,000 22 May 2002
78 CLEVELAND ROAD Flats/Maisonettes £1,344,949 £400,000 12 Jul 2001
78A CLEVELAND ROAD Flats/Maisonettes £552,813 £305,000 11 Nov 2005
80 CLEVELAND ROAD Semi-Detached £2,229,595 £1,560,000 20 Aug 2015
82 CLEVELAND ROAD Semi-Detached £1,260,217 £1,087,000 19 Nov 2020
84 CLEVELAND ROAD Semi-Detached £1,368,336 £1,100,000 21 Jun 2018